Head-to-Head Comparison
| Funding Pips | Metric | Wall Street Funded |
|---|---|---|
| 7.9/10 ★ | PFM Score | 7.2/10 |
| 4.5/5 (52,621) | TrustPilot | 4.5/5 (3,203) |
| A+ ★ | Safety Grade | B+ |
| 73.6 B+ ★ | Trust Score | 61.4 B |
| 80-100% | Profit Split | 80% (up to 100% via VIP scaling program) |
| 3% (Zero/2-Step Pro), 4% (1-Step), 5% (2-Step Standard) | Daily Drawdown | 4% (Rapid); 5% (Classic, Ultra); no daily limit (Elite); 3% (Instant Standard & Instant Pro) |
| Weekly | Payout Frequency | Every 10 days |
| $29 | Starting Price | $23 ★ |
| Proprietary | Technology | White-Label |
| cTrader, Match Trader, MT5 | Platforms | cTrader, Match Trader, MT5 |
| No | Direct Path to Funded | No |
| United Arab Emirates | Country | United Arab Emirates |
| Oct 2022 | Established | Dec 2023 |
| 21 options | Challenge Options | 35 options |

Funding Pips vs Wall Street Funded: Detailed Analysis
Funding Pips and Wall Street Funded are both CFD firms. Funding Pips has been in business longer, established in 2022, while Wall Street Funded was founded in 2023.
In terms of pricing, Wall Street Funded is more affordable with challenges starting at $23, which is $6 less than Funding Pips's starting price of $29. Funding Pips offers 21 challenge options, while Wall Street Funded offers 35.
Funding Pips offers 80-100% profit split, while Wall Street Funded offers 80% (up to 100% via VIP scaling program). Funding Pips pays out Weekly, and Wall Street Funded pays out Every 10 days.
For trust and reputation, Funding Pips has a 4.5/5 TrustPilot rating with 52,621 reviews, while Wall Street Funded has 4.5/5 with 3,203 reviews. Safety grades: Funding Pips A+, Wall Street Funded B+.
